Signing of the covenant and list of signatories. The covenant includes an initial, broad stipulation that acts as a fundamental law, encompassing all the precepts. Next, specific laws requiring current attention are outlined: the law of segregation in matrimonial matters, the law of the Sabbath as a sign of the covenant, and the law of the jubilee or periodic remission of debts to promote social justice. Finally, cultic precepts are incorporated using different terminology and styles.
